IP查询
查询
你查询的IP:[121.4.173.3] 地理位置:中国–上海–上海
最新查询
116.76.9.191
121.59.185.0
59.172.78.205
221.8.37.210
120.52.255.241
210.12.94.65
123.103.211.78
116.69.189.226
122.4.224.97
121.4.173.3
119.148.160.241
202.122.32.215
202.63.248.153
124.200.95.51
124.196.101.121
116.112.246.192
125.61.128.80
203.175.192.78
202.173.224.177
123.176.80.151
116.204.228.178
60.208.219.219
203.158.16.43
210.2.90.93
121.52.224.241
58.30.44.95
122.156.211.173
161.207.105.50
202.136.224.125
116.116.129.134
122.64.105.247